Behold, the POWER of the SUN!

That was some serious hype there. But it just looked like, I dunno, a small building with a streetlight on top? I didn't see this in the theater but it was in a dark room on a 70" 4K TV, and I was not impressed. Hard to imagine this is what they intended us to see when the script was written. I kind of think the production designer dropped the ball, or maybe lackluster VFX is to blame.
